Checking Out


Option 1: Check Out with Hall Staff

  • The Hall Staff member that assists during checkouts where students are present does not determine damage charges.
  • An assessment of potential damages and/or charges is not provided when completing a checkout this way.
  • This is an opportunity to point out or explain any damages. The Hall Staff member will note any explanations received.

Option 2: Express Checkout

  • Visit the front desk and follow posted instructions to complete an Express Checkout.
  • Completing an Express Checkout waives the right to appeal any damages and associated charges found when the room is assessed.

Late Stay


Students can request a Late Stay through the Housing Portal under ‘Important Forms’. The Late Stay cost is $100 and covers up to one week beginning the day the halls close.

Damages


Per the University Housing Contract, upon inspection residents are assessed damage charges for any damages to the unit, its fixtures, and/or any appliances and furniture identified in the Room Condition Inventory (RCI) Report Form completed at the beginning of occupancy.

Failure to complete the RCI form or report damages on the RCI form correctly does not excuse residents from returning the room to the condition at initial occupancy or from any subsequent charges assessed by Housing & Residence Life.
